秋招笔试准备题库及答案.docxVIP

  • 0
  • 0
  • 约5.31千字
  • 约 9页
  • 2026-01-05 发布于河南
  • 举报

秋招笔试准备题库及答案

姓名:__________考号:__________

一、单选题(共10题)

1.以下哪个选项是Python中的元组类型?()

A.list

B.tuple

C.set

D.dict

2.在Python中,如何定义一个函数?()

A.functionmyFunction():

B.defmyFunction():

C.myFunction():

D.function(myFunction):

3.以下哪个不是Python中的内置数据类型?()

A.int

B.str

C.list

D.class

4.在Python中,如何实现一个列表的长度统计?()

A.len(list)

B.list.size()

C.list.length()

D.list.count()

5.以下哪个不是Python中的异常处理关键字?()

A.try

B.catch

C.except

D.finally

6.在Python中,如何进行字符串的格式化输出?()

A.print(string.format())

B.print(string%variables)

C.print(str.format(string,variables)

D.print(string.format(variables)

7.以下哪个是Python中的列表推导式?()

A.[xforxinrange(5)]

B.forxinrange(5):

C.list(xforxinrange(5))

D.[x|xinrange(5)]

8.在Python中,如何定义一个全局变量?()

A.globalvariable

B.defvariable:

C.variable=variable

D.globalvariable=value

9.以下哪个是Python中的多继承方式?()

A.classChild(Parent1,Parent2):

B.classChild(Parent1,Parent2):

C.classChild(Parent1):Parent2

D.classChild(Parent1,Parent2):

10.在Python中,如何定义一个字典?()

A.dict={key:value}

B.dict(key,value)

C.dictionary(key,value)

D.dict[key]=value

二、多选题(共5题)

11.以下哪些是Python中的可变数据类型?()

A.int

B.list

C.str

D.set

E.tuple

12.在Python中,以下哪些是有效的赋值操作?()

A.x=y

B.y=x

C.x+=1

D.x-=1

E.x=x+1

13.以下哪些是Python中的条件语句?()

A.if

B.elif

C.else

D.when

E.case

14.以下哪些是Python中的循环语句?()

A.for

B.while

C.do

D.until

E.loop

15.以下哪些是Python中的文件操作方法?()

A.open

B.read

C.write

D.close

E.seek

三、填空题(共5题)

16.Python中用于注释单行代码的符号是______。

17.在Python中,将一个字符串变量赋值给另一个变量,使用______操作符。

18.在Python中,表示字符串结束的转义字符是______。

19.在Python中,一个空字典可以使用______关键字来创建。

20.在Python中,用于检查变量是否存在于字典中的关键字是______。

四、判断题(共5题)

21.在Python中,所有数字类型都是不可变的。()

A.正确B.错误

22.在Python中,可以使用等号(=)来进行比较操作。()

A.正确B.错误

23.在Python中,列表(list)是可变的数据类型。()

A.正确B.错误

24.在Python中,字符串(str)是不可变的。()

A.正确B.错误

25.在Python中,字典(dict)的键必须是唯一的。

您可能关注的文档

文档评论(0)

1亿VIP精品文档

相关文档